    Mrs. Helen G. Carrier, 89, 970 Hwy. 91, Elizabethton, went home to be with her Lord on Saturday, June 16, 2007 at Johnson City Medical Center Hospital following an extended illness.

    Mrs. Carrier was a native of Carter County and was the daughter of the late Frank L. and Lena Rainbolt Gouge. In addition to her parents Mrs. Carrier was preceded in death by three brothers and two sisters.

    Mrs. Carrier was a member of Watuaga Valley Freewill Baptist Church. She was a former employee of Bemberg and Beaunit Fibers and was a member of the hospital auxiliary and served as a Pink Lady at Carter County Hospital. Mrs. Carrier loved to quilt and had made quilts for her three children and her eight grandchildren. She loved flowers and gardening.

    ELIZABETHTON - Ralph Gouge, age 92, of Elizabethton, passed away on Tuesday, August 8, 2017 at Sycamore Shoals Hospital, following an extended illness.

    Ralph was born in Carter County, Tennessee to the late Frank Leslie Gouge and Lena Rainbolt Gouge. In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his wife of 47 years, Orlena Vines Gouge; and his special friend, Rose Hodge; three sisters, Novella Williams, Helen Carrier, and Vivian Elliott; three brothers, Howard Gouge, Fred Gouge, and Strail Gouge; and one grandson, Charles G. Pierce.

    Ralph was a World War II Army veteran and was a former member of Hunter First Baptist Church. He retired as a machinist at UNIVAC and was a member of the Senior Dance Group. He enjoyed dancing, was an avid fisherman, gardening, but most of all he loved children – he was "Daddy" and "Papaw" to many.

    Eddie F. Williams, 73, of Leesburg, Fla., passed away suddenly on Monday, July 15, 2019. Born and raised in Elizabethton, Tenn., Eddie attended the University of Tennessee where he earned his B.S. in Electrical Engineering. Shortly after beginning his career, he was drafted into the U.S. Army in 1968. After his service, he worked 32 years in Civil Service at the Naval Air Warfare Center in Orlando, Fla., building flight and ship simulators for the U.S. government. He retired in 2000 and moved back to his hometown of Elizabethton, where he resided for 17 years with his wife, Sharon. He then moved with Sharon to Leesburg and lived happily for two years near his daughter, Rebecca, and son-in-law, Stefan, preceding his death.
    Eddie loved gardening, plants and blooms, and most of all, orchids. He loved all things technological and was a history buff. Eddie had a love for food and you oftentimes found him with a sweet treat or cooking up a new recipe in the kitchen.
    He loved walking his best friend, Miniature Schnauzer, Jasper, and chatting with all the neighbors.

    LEBANON - Shelby Jean Carrier Williams, age 81, of Lebanon, Tennessee, formerly of Elizabethton, Tennessee went home to be with the Lord on Monday, February 3, 2020 at Vanderbilt University Medical Center, surrounded by her loving family.

    Shelby was born in Carter County to the late Walter J. and Helen Gouge Carrier. In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by a brother, Danny Carrier.

    Shelby was a loving wife, mother and grandmother and was of the Baptist faith. She had worked in various positions in the banking industry. Shelby enjoyed traveling, blue grass music, cooking, reading and quilting, but her family was her true source of happiness.
